Increase Site Effectiveness with Professional Drupal Maintenance Techniques
Increase Site Effectiveness with Professional Drupal Maintenance Techniques
Blog Article
Being familiar with the Importance of Drupal Routine maintenance
What exactly is Drupal Servicing?
Drupal maintenance refers back to the ongoing technique of ensuring that a Drupal Web page operates effortlessly, securely, and proficiently. This encompasses many different tasks starting from frequent program updates, stability patches, efficiency enhancements, and written content management, to backups and monitoring. Typical Drupal Maintenance will help to circumvent downtime, assures the most recent features are carried out, and keeps the location compliant with current Website requirements.
Why Normal Updates Issue for Stability
Stability is amongst the Main issues for almost any website, and Drupal is no exception. Regular updates are critical to shield the website from vulnerabilities that destructive entities could exploit. Each individual new version of Drupal comes along with fixes for recognized safety issues, making it vital to stay up-to-day. Failure to carry out these updates may result in facts breaches, loss of sensitive facts, and harm to your name.
The Affect of Routine maintenance on Efficiency
The upkeep program substantially impacts a website’s functionality. With out typical checks and updates, a Drupal website might load little by little or behave unpredictably, leading to a poor consumer knowledge. Typical maintenance can improve performance by cleaning up unused modules and themes, optimizing the database, and guaranteeing that caching mechanisms are effectively utilized. These enhancements add to speedier load times, improving person satisfaction and potentially boosting Web optimization rankings.
Widespread Problems in Drupal Routine maintenance
Identifying Typical Issues and Their Solutions
Preserving a Drupal site will not be devoid of its troubles. Widespread difficulties include plugin conflicts, server misconfigurations, and out-of-date themes. Pinpointing these issues often entails checking logs, functionality metrics, and consumer opinions. Remedies can range from systematic troubleshooting, screening updates in the staging natural environment, or consulting with a specialist to employ the necessary fixes. Normal audits might also help in pinpointing possible troubles ahead of they escalate.
Managing Third-Bash Modules and Plugins
Drupal’s comprehensive ecosystem of 3rd-celebration modules can drastically enrich features. Having said that, they might also introduce vulnerabilities and compatibility challenges. It’s vital to vet Each individual module properly ahead of set up and on a regular basis assessment and update them. Maintaining conversation with module developers through Neighborhood message boards may also supply insights into prospective concerns and impending updates. Moreover, setting up a demanding exam suite can protect against problematic modules from causing disruptions in your Reside web site.
Handling Drupal Model Updates Easily
Upgrading Drupal to a newer version can substantially enhance features and stability, nonetheless it includes hazards. System updates can break compatibility with existing themes and modules. Consequently, it's recommended to comply with a detailed enhance prepare that features again-ups and a tests stage in a non-production atmosphere. Additionally, leveraging automatic enhance scripts can streamline this method even though minimizing faults and downtime.
Very best Procedures for Productive Drupal Servicing
Creating a Upkeep Schedule
Developing a routine maintenance plan is crucial in making sure no element of your Drupal site is disregarded. This routine should really outline particular tasks to become carried out day by day, weekly, every month, and yearly. Day-to-day duties might consist of monitoring protection alerts and examining web page effectiveness, even though weekly tasks might entail updating written content and checking for out there updates. Month to month and once-a-year tasks can incorporate detailed backups, efficiency audits, and stability evaluations. Consistence inside your servicing plan assists preemptively deal with prospective problems.
Employing Automatic Applications for Effectiveness
Automation can considerably reduce the workload involved in Drupal maintenance. You will find powerful resources that can help with responsibilities such as monitoring, backups, and updates. Resources like Drush or Aegir can automate many tasks, making certain that your website is consistently updated with out handbook intervention. Additionally, significant checking solutions can provide you with a warning of any downtime or functionality issues, enabling for swift motion to take care of them ahead of they escalate.
Conducting Standard Functionality Audits
Overall performance audits are important for evaluating your Drupal web-site’s effectiveness and speed. By employing quite a few performance metrics which include webpage load time, server response time, and throughput, you'll be able to sort a clear photo of how efficiently your web site operates. Conducting audits frequently lets you pinpoint regions for improvement, assisting to apply optimizations that can lead to a greater person expertise and improved SEO general performance.
Innovative Procedures for Optimizing Drupal Servicing
Leveraging Caching Techniques
Caching is a strong strategy in World-wide-web overall performance optimization, and it plays an important job in Drupal maintenance. By configuring caching properly working with resources like Varnish or maybe the constructed-in caching mechanisms in Drupal, Internet websites can considerably lower load times and server load. Caching techniques incorporate webpage caching for total rendered webpages, block caching for dynamic written content, and sights caching for databases queries, which could significantly enhance web site responsiveness and lessen source usage.
Monitoring Web page Well being with Analytics
Analytics applications present useful insights into your internet site’s overall performance and user interactions. Applying Google Analytics or other equivalent applications can observe person conduct, traffic resources, and engagement metrics, all of which notify decision-creating and system. Frequently examining this information aids in identifying trends and probable problems while enabling you to definitely tailor your content and performance optimally, holding your buyers engaged and pleased.
Integrating Backup Methods Successfully
Backups certainly are a significant facet of Drupal servicing, ensuring you could speedily Recuperate from any facts reduction or web page failure. A highly effective backup solution involves not just normal automatic backups of data files and databases but will also right testing to make certain backups is usually restored. Leveraging instruments such as Backup and Migrate, which can be precisely made for Drupal, can drastically streamline this site web process, offering assurance that your data is preserved should any concerns occur.
Measuring Accomplishment in Drupal Servicing
Critical General performance Metrics to Track
To accurately measure the good results of one's Drupal upkeep efforts, particular critical performance indicators (KPIs) must be tracked. These can include web-site uptime, common load time, responsiveness to person requests, protection incident occurrences, and user actions analytics. Developing obvious benchmarks for these KPIs will allow you to gauge improvement with time and refine your routine maintenance approaches properly.
Evaluating Person Encounter Post-Routine maintenance
Put up-upkeep evaluations are basic in assessing the success of one's endeavours. Collecting user feedback by way of surveys or immediate communication can give valuable insights into their activities in advance of and after routine maintenance. Moreover, checking engagement metrics, like bounce prices or session durations, will provide data to know the impact of your respective servicing activities on user gratification and retention.
Producing Details-Driven Advancements
The significance of knowledge-driven insights can’t be overstated in creating a good maintenance system. Analysing the data acquired from efficiency metrics, person feedback, and analytics will let you employ informed adjustments. This enables for continual improvement of your website, ensuring it fulfills user anticipations and maintains best functionality. Routinely examining and responding to this details implies that your Drupal web page will not likely only be existing but may also provide your people effectively.
In conclusion, a strong Drupal routine maintenance method is important for a secure, performant, and user-centric Internet site. By being familiar with the necessity of servicing, addressing common difficulties, pursuing very best tactics, employing Sophisticated tactics, and measuring achievement effectively, you'll be able to be certain your Drupal site carries on to prosper in an at any time-evolving electronic landscape.